Digestive Healthcare Center Re-Opens Warren Office After Top-Notch Renovations

WARREN, NJ (November 9, 2015) – Digestive Healthcare Center (DHC) is pleased to announce that renovations for their Warren office, at 31 Mountain Boulevard, Suite H, are officially complete. As of October 22, 2015, this newly renovated office is now accepting new and existing patients.

“We are very excited to have our services available again to Warren and the surrounding communities,” stated Dr. Charles Accurso, Medical Director and Founder, DHC. “I am very pleased with our new space and the amenities we can offer our patients. The goal of this renovation was to better serve the community with a fresh, full-service facility and I believe we achieved that goal.”

The Warren office is now open five days a week to local patients with gastroenterological conditions. In addition to the Warren location, DHC also has locations in Hillsborough and Somerville, New Jersey.

An official ribbon cutting ceremony is to be determined to officiate the re-opening.
